DescriptionAt the Ohrmann Museum and Gallery you will be introduced to the unique paintings of Bill Ohrmann, retired rancher, life-long artist, and in these paintings, spokesman for the earth. With his brush, he has expressed his no holds barred view of man's inhumanity to nature, to each other, and to the creatures with which we share this planet. Alternating with the scenes of mayhem and dire predictions are hopeful, inspiring scenes of how it was or how it should be.
Also at the gallery are life-sized welded steel sculptures of elk, buffalo, bear, and a woolly mammoth. These pieces are done in a realism style and must be seen to be appreciated.
Bronzes, woodcarvings and clay sculptures are also on display.
DirectionsThe Ohrmann Museum and Gallery is located 2 1/2 miles south of Drummond, Montana on Highway 1.
